Informatica Cloud Summer 2010 Release Now Available

Informatica Corporation the world’s number one independent provider of enterprise data integration software, today announced the general availability of the Informatica Cloud Summer 2010 release. The new release significantly broadens the company’s award winning data integration Cloud Services with pre-packaged plug-ins that enable data quality and business-to-business (B2B) data transformation in the cloud.

With Informatica Cloud Summer 2010, customers and partners can also build and share custom plug-ins through the Informatica Marketplace and take advantage of pre-packaged connectivity for applications such as Salesforce, Oracle, SAP, Microsoft, Xactly, Right 90, Big Machines and numerous others.

Cloud9 Analytics Closes $8 Million Round Of Funding

Cloud9 Analytics, a provider of SaaS business analytics for line-of-business managers, today announced it has closed its Series C financing for $8 million. The financing round was led by Mayfield Fund, with participation from existing investors InterWest Partners and Leapfrog Ventures. This brings its total in funding to $21.6 million.

Rajeev Batra of Mayfield Fund joins the Cloud9 Analytics Board of Directors.

Symplified Trust Cloud Weaves Unified Access Management Capabilities into Amazon EC2 Fabric

Symplified, the Cloud security company, today announced Symplified Trust Cloud™ -- the first unified identity and access management (IAM) solution designed for enterprises using the Amazon EC2 (elastic compute cloud) platform to run their applications in the cloud. Symplified Trust Cloud enables organizations to meet US, European Union, and country-specific compliance mandates for data governance; accelerate the implementation of SAML single sign-on (SSO) federation; and deploy IAM for their cloud resources in days.

“Organizations wishing to move applications to the cloud have been held back by the lack of truly native cloud-based identity management solutions.  This has forced enterprises to choose either fragmented management of identity across multiple cloud application providers (with the inconvenience of multiple user logons) or an inefficient hybrid of cloud-hosted applications and on-premises identity management,” said Bob Blakley, vice president and research director for industry research firm Burton Group. “The cloud’s promise won’t be realized until identity management can provide a single source of user administration, hosted in a cloud datacenter, supporting single sign on to multiple cloud applications by users whose accounts are managed in multiple cloud repositories.”

BMC Software Exceeds $100 Million in "Cloud Foundation" Deals

Major customers across multiple verticals select BMC in deals involving virtualization and cloud management

Single, unified IT management a "must have" for companies seeking benefits of physical, virtual, and cloud-based IT

BMC Software has announced that it has passed the $100 million mark in highly strategic "cloud foundation" deals where virtualization and computing management capabilities were the key element in the customer's final selection.
